DROID PRO by Motorola Fact Sheet

Productivity Powerhouse

Oct. 05, 2010  

Part business, part casual and all smartphone – DROID PRO by Motorola makes the most of your time. Staying productive at work is a priority, but managing your personal life is just as important. Featuring a PC-like browsing experience with Adobe® Flash® Player 10.1, a 1 GHz super-fast processor and corporate access, you’ll have plenty of time for work, play and everything in between.

Efficient and Effective

DROID PRO is a mobile office in your pocket. The 1 GHz processor makes for fast connections when you’re on a deadline.  With access to your corporate work directory, you can check availability, propose new meeting times and even reschedule appointments right on the device. QuickOffice Mobile Suite gives you the capability to edit documents right in hand, and drafting quick messages is easy with a large, spacious QWERTY keyboard. DROID PRO will stay with you all day long thanks to extended battery life, allowing for hours of talk time. DROID PRO also allows consumers to use the phone as a 3G Mobile Hotspot to connect up to five other Wi-Fi enabled devices/laptops.

Dress It Up

DROID PRO comes ready to customize as you see fit. With thousands of apps to choose from on Android MarketTM, you can tailor the device to your preferences. You have one touch access to your calendar, e-mail, social networks and even news right at your fingertips. A large 3.1 inch display allows you to enjoy all of your content with clear views right on the device, including images taken with the 5 megapixel camera. Digital Living Network Alliance (DLNA®) connectivity allows you to stream, store and share content with multiple DLNA-enabled devices around your home.

Super Secure

Rest easy knowing DROID PRO is extra secure. With corporate-level security, it’s the first Android device with data encryption (available early 2011) and the ability to completely have your phone and SD card wiped if it’s ever lost or stolen. Remote password management allows you to change and check passwords on the road, so you can be confident in your security. With this elevated corporate-level security, you won’t have to worry about your information getting into the wrong hands. 

DROID PRO by Motorola

Talk and Standby Time1

CDMA TT/SB Time (up to): 430 mins / 320 hrs

WCDMA TT/SB Time (up to): 420 mins / 320 hrs

GSM TT/SB Time (up to): 470 mins / 300 hrs

WLAN TT/SB Time (up to): 580 mins / 135 hrs

Bands/Modes

CDMA 800/1900 EVDO-Rev.A, Dual-band Rx Diversity, GSM 850/900/1800/1900, WCDMA 850/1900/2100, HSDPA 10.2 Mbps, HSUPA 5.76 Mbps (Category 9), EDGE Class 12, GPRS Class 12

Weight

134 grams

Dimensions

 60(x) 119(y) 11.70(z)

Bluetooth

Bluetooth Class 1, Version 2.1+EDR

OS

Android 2.2

Battery

1420 mAH Standard & 1860 mAH Extended

Connectivity

3.5mm, USB 2.0 HS, Corporate Sync,  DLNA,  GOTA,  NGP,  PC Sync

Display

3.1” 320x480 HVGA 

Messaging/Web/Apps

EMS,  MMS,  SMS, Email (EAS,  Google Mail,  POP3/IMAP embedded,  Push Email,  Yahoo Mail) IM (Java, Embedded), WebKit browser w/ Flash

Audio

AAC,  AAC+,  AMR NB,  AMR WB,  MIDI,  MP3,  WMA v10,  WMA v9

Video

Capture/Playback/Streaming, H.263,  H.264,  MPEG4, D1(480p)

Camera

5 MP, Auto Focus, Digital zoom, Dual-LED flash

Memory

2GB internal memory, 2GB pre loaded - expandable to 32GB with SD 

512MB RAM x 2GB ROM, 1.5GB user available memory

Form Factor

Touch QWERTY bar

Antenna

Internal, dual diversity antennae

Location Services

aGPS (assisted), Standalone GPS, Google Maps™, Google Maps™ Navigation, Google Maps™ with Google Latitude, Street View, and eCompass
